Cafe Triangle Restaurant boasts a diverse menu with 67 distinct dishes spanning breakfast, lunch, and dinner options. From hearty breakfasts like pancakes and Haitian spaghetti to mouthwatering main courses featuring fried pork and mixed green salads, each dish caters to a variety of tastes.

Pricing is friendly on the pocket, with an average cost of just $9.00 across the menu.

Patrons enjoy a selection of drinks such as refreshing Sprite, rich Akasan, or simply water, all either complementing the meal or quenching a thirst after savoring flavorful dishes.

3/8/22: I was able to order my food 30mins before 11pm (right before they close) and was very satisfied with the customer service. They were able to make a last-minute change with no problem. For that I will always eat there plus the food was freshly cooked and the turkey was very tender. I'm glad that I gave them a chance, without a doubt I'm going back. Pros- Stays open late, accept cash and credit cards, clean establishment, friendly staff. Cons- I should have known about Cafe Triangle before now!

Food is really good I order off uber eats a lot but the only complaint is that you HAVE to write rice and bean/pea or they will not include it with the meal. I have never seen that before and it's disappointing that they just don't include it automatically..and they also don't always give the rice I request but I always let it slide because it's so freaking good. So that's for anyone wondering about to order or not. (YES.)
